全国服务热线:
0592-5794349
当前位置:首页> 新闻中心

软件公司跨平台应用程序开发注意事项:何时,为何以及如何?

* 来源: * 作者: * 发表时间: 2019-08-08 18:23:41 * 浏览: 64
软件公司发现,在某些情况下,跨平台应用程序开发可能会使结果不如本机本机软件开发。跨平台技术的主要优势是能够以一种语言适应移动和Web应用程序。项目启动时,业务流程是了解您需要软件应用程序的原因以及您要查找的内容。让我们考虑六个跨平台开发作为更好的选择:#1。节省一分钱就是为了赚一分钱,金钱,金钱,金钱,一定是有趣的富人世界是ABBA的着名歌词。这是事实:如果您不习惯花钱,预算应用程序是一种选择。跨平台应用程序开发比本机开发便宜。想想Evernote,你会感到惊讶。众所周知的制作笔记的应用程序是混合的:所有设备都可以访问笔记,并且UI在任何地方都是相同的。在投资iOS开发之前,Evernote所有者推出了一个跨平台的应用程序,赢得了客户的忠诚度,并决定了向前发展的方向。如果您想保存项目启动并在实践中测试这个想法,请选择跨平台应用程序开发。 #2。很短的时间,你是否渴望实现自己的想法?跨平台应用程序开发是在其他人创建应用程序之前发布应用程序的好方法。当Asana推出系统的移动版本以帮助团队跟踪他们的工作时,Asana使用这种技术。当Facebook联合创始人Dustin Moskovitz和前Facebook工程师Justin Rosenstein于2008年创立Asana时,他们旨在快速更新所有移动平台的应用程序功能。一开始,只有跨平台开发才能做到这一点。如果任务是发布应用程序ldquo,昨天选择跨平台应用程序开发。 #3。想象一下较小功能的数量,您想出了一个仅限于一些功能的简单应用程序。基本功能易于实现,跨平台应用程序开发,甚至更易于维护。例如,Instagram是具有较少基本功能的更成功的跨平台应用程序之一。它从两个功能开始:上传照片和查看新闻Feed。当然,目前世界上更受欢迎的社交网络正在开发中,现在,Instagram为用户提供了更多的机会。但重要的是要记住其开端的根源。如果您遵循“ldquo”,则规则少于多个,请选择跨平台应用程序开发。给我们一个自适应UI!移动平台是不同的。因此,与相同的应用UI相比,跨平台开发的问题是低响应性。随着软件技术的兴起,这个问题已经退居幕后。新的框架Ionic在开发人员中越来越受欢迎,其工作是一个奇迹。 Ionic提供多种标准UI组件 - 您可以轻松创建与此类似的界面元素。我们在为大型电气设备供应商开发跨平台应用程序时进行了实践测试。即使员工从Android平板电脑更改为WindowsPhone,也必须为员工提供视觉上熟悉的UI移动解决方案。 Ion 2有助于实现这一目标。如果要维护自适应应用程序界面并且与所有平台上的本机类似,请选择跨平台开发。 #5。提高应用程序性能任何企业家的梦想都是立即为所有流行平台生成高质量的应用程序。任何开发人员的梦想都是为iOS和Android应用程序编写代码,而不会降低质量和性能。直到最近,这是不可能的:跨平台解决方案明显失去了本地发展。当Facebook为自己制作ReactJS时,一切都会发生变化,然后在移动应用中使用ReactNative。 ReactNative(例如NativeScript)允许您使用一种语言编写应用程序代码,并将本机元素用于不同的平台。这些框架的流行程度正在与使用它们创建的应用程序一样快。例如,Airbnb混合应用程序是使用ReactNative开发的。如果您需要高性能应用程序,请在ReactNative或NativeScript上选择跨平台开发。 #6。公司规则BYOD在许多公司中无处不在。当CEO向我们询问企业应用程序和员工时,CEO应该怎么做他们自己的设备(从小米到iPhone)?跨平台应用程序开发非常适合企业应用程序。想象一下像E&Y这样的咨询公司,有数千名审计师和分析师。每天他们都必须去他们的客户办公室并使用移动设备而不是PC。为了实现从桌面到平板电脑的轻松过渡,开发人员创建了跨平台解决方案。软件开发公司建议,如果您正在考虑为您的企业使用通用解决方案,请选择跨平台开发。